Hands-on Class Project
Design Brief:
Relax and have fun! Paint watercolor strawberries :) feel free to add more berries, leaves and other elements to your illustration.
SUPPLIES:
- Watercolor Paper
- Watercolor Paint (I use "White Nights" watercolor paints by Nevskaya Palitra)
- Water
- Paper towel
- Paint Palette
- Pencil
- Eraser
- Small watercolor brush (kolinski sable #2)
- Medium watercolor brush (kolinski sable #4)
- Black Fineliner
- White ink (or gouache, or white gel pen)
